1. RANAVAT is an innovative beauty brand founded by South Asian scientist turned entrepreneur Michelle Ranavat. Working to soothe and hydrate all skin types her Royal Tonique Hydrating Jasmine Mist, £45, is part toner, part facial spray packed with jasmine sourced directly from a flower garden in West India.
2. This brightening serum has turmeric and ashwagandha as well as 15% vitamin C all working in harmony to reduce the appearance of dark spots and redness, fight free radicals, hydrate and rejuvenate while leaving a healthy glow. 15% Vitamin C Serum, £29 Indé Wild
3. Founded by Nikita and Akash Mehta, siblings with a shared mission of introducing Indian wisdom to Western hair care rituals, Fable & Mane’s Holiroots Hair Oil, £29, melds the alchemy of Indian plants with divine scents to thicken and strengthen hair.
